薄板坯连铸结晶器中铸坯凝固壳应力发展的有限元分析

摘    要:对薄板坯连铸结晶中铸坯凝固壳应力的发展过程建立了有限元分析模型。在计算铸坯温度场和凝壳厚度分布的基础上用热弹粘性模型数值模拟了凝固壳中的应力发展过程,同时得到了凝壳断面从结晶器液池顶面到结晶器出口处的移支过程中各部位裂纹产生倾向的大小。模型中考虑了钢水静压力的作用和结晶器锥度,计算结果合理。

Finite Element Analysis on Stress Development of SolidifyingShell in the Mold of Continuously Cast Steel Thin Slabs

Abstract:The finite element analysis mold has been developed for stress analysis of solidifyins shell in the con-tinuous slab casting mold. A thermo-elasticvisco rnold is applied to simulate the stress development ofsolidifying shell after distributions of temperature and solidifying shell thickness were obtained. At thesame time, the poseibility of crack occurance on the surfaces of thin slab is predicted when the simulat-ing slice travels from the top of a liquid pool to the exit of slab mold. The influences of static pressureof molten steel and the taper of mold have been taken into account. The calculated results are reason-able, and could be used for the analysis on stress and cracks.
